Dustjacket has minor shelfwear and rubbing.; A large number of Greek religious poems in hexameter were attributed to Orpheus as they were to similar miracle-man figures like Bakis Musaeus Abaris Aristeas Epimenides and the Sybil. Of this vast literature only two examples survive whole: a set of hymns composed at some point in the 2nd or 3rd century AD and an Orphic Argonautica composed somewhere between the 4th and 6th centuries AD. Earlier Orphic literature which may date back as far as the 6th century BC survives only in papyrus scraps or in quotations by later authors.; 296 pages; Sandpiper reprint of 1983 Edition. . 0198148542 . Dustjacket has faint creasing; 0.85 x 9.32 x 6.32 Inches; 240 pages; Theseus is celebrated as the greatest of Athenian heroes. This work explores what he meant to the Athenians at the height of their city-state in the fifth century B. C. Assembling material that has been scattered in scholarly works Henry Walker examines the evidence for the development of themyth and cult of Theseus in the archaic age. He then looks to major works of classical literature in which Theseus figures exploring the contradictions between the archaic primitive side of his character and his refurbished image as the patron of democracy. His ambiguous nature as outsider flouting accepted standards of behavior while at the same time being a hero-king and a representative of higher ideals is analyzed through his representations in the work of Bacchylides Euripides and Sophocles. This is the only work of scholarship that examines the literary representation ofTheseus so thoroughly. It brings to life a literary character whose virtues flaws and contradictions belong in no less a degree to his creators the people of Athens. . 0195089081 . Oxford University Press hardcover
